#0b0b0d color information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b0b0d is composed of 4.3% red, 4.3%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.4%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 94.9%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 8.3% and a lightness of 4.7%. #0b0b0d color hex could be obtained by blending #16161a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

#0b0b0d color conversion

The hexadecimal color #0b0b0d has RGB values of R:11, G:11,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.95. Its decimal value is 723725.

  • Hex triplet 0b0b0d
    #0b0b0d
  • RGB Decimal 11, 11, 13
    rgb(11,11,13)
  • RGB Percent 4.3, 4.3, 5.1
    rgb(4.3%,4.3%,5.1%)
  • CMYK 15, 15, 0, 95
  • HSL 240°, 8.3, 4.7
    hsl(240,8%,5%)
  • HSV (or HSB) 240°, 15.4, 5.1
  • Web Safe 000000
    #000000
  • CIE-LAB 3.067, 0.311, -0.846
  • XYZ 0.33, 0.34, 0.429
  • xyY 0.301, 0.309, 0.34
  • CIE-LCH 3.067, 0.902, 290.158
  • CIE-LUV 3.067, -0.037, -0.515
  • Hunter-Lab 5.827, -0.079, -0.285
  • Binary 00001011, 00001011, 00001101
